Netflix could suffer a downward spiral to the popularity of their fantasy show The Witcher following their shock casting news

Over the weekend Netflix announced, Henry Cavill will be replaced by Liam Hemsworth for season four of The Witcher.

Not everyone has taken the news well.

Cavill has played the lead role of Geralt in two seasons of the hit fantasy series, and will reprise the role for a forthcoming third series.

However, the streaming service announced on Saturday (29 October) that a fourth season had been commissioned – but Hunger Games star Hemsworth would be taking over the role.

Twitter account @CultureCrave polled their followers and after over 200,000 responses the results overwhelmingly found that people were planning to ditch The Witcher.

Of those who responded, 81.9 percent of people said they wouldn’t be watching The Witcher season four once Cavill left.

One person on Twitter said ‘f**k these endless, soulless, faithless adaptations’, while another said they didn’t blame Cavill as he ‘had to work with people who don’t care about the character or the source material’.

Someone else claimed the actor was ‘the only person involved with that show who gave a s**t about The Witcher’, arguing that he was ‘constantly fighting’ to keep the series in line with the books.

Filming has already wrapped on season three, which is due to be released next year and once it’s done Cavill will no longer be leading the show.

In a statement issued by Netflix, Cavill said: “My journey as Geralt of Rivia has been filled with both monsters and adventures, and alas, I will be laying down my medallion and my swords for Season four.

“In my stead, the fantastic Mr. Liam Hemsworth will be taking up the mantle of the White Wolf. As with the greatest of literary characters, I pass the torch with reverence for the time spent embodying Geralt and enthusiasm to see Liam’s take on this most fascinating and nuanced of men.

“Liam, good sir, this character has such a wonderful depth to him, enjoy diving in and seeing what you can find,” he added.

Hemsworth also reacted to the news in a statement, saying he was “over the moon” at the chance to play Geralt.

“Henry Cavill has been an incredible Geralt, and I’m honoured that he’s handing me the reins and allowing me to take up the White Wolf’s blades for the next chapter of his adventure,” said Hemsworth.

“Henry, I’ve been a fan of yours for years and was inspired by what you brought to this beloved character. I may have some big boots to fill, but I’m truly excited to be stepping into The Witcher world.”
